Two men were on Monday charged with committing robbery under arms on Christopher Harricharan at Plantation Opposite, Essequibo Coast and one pleaded guilty.

Robin Patrick, a 22-year-old miner of Charity Housing Scheme, Essequibo Coast, and Munesh Ramsarup, 30, of Charity Back Street, Essequibo Coast, both appeared before Magistrate Esther Sam at the Anna Regina Magistrate’s Court where the charge was read.

Patrick pleaded guilty to the offence and was sentenced to 30 months imprisonment while Ramsarup pleaded not guilty and was released on $150,000 bail.

They were both arrested on Friday.

The matter was adjourned until February 1.
